Address

1KLhHaJVZyjEqrBPYy6UxXvuDkXPLtgMB8

0 BTC

Confirmed
Total Received0.3180035 BTC
Total Sent0.3180035 BTC
Final Balance0 BTC
No. Transactions2

Transactions

1KLhHaJVZyjEqrBPYy6UxXvuDkXPLtgMB80.3180035 BTC